Engineer Software 3

Sportsman's Warehouse
South Jordan, United States of America
2 days ago

Role details

Contract type
Permanent cont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
English
Experience level
Senior

Job location

South Jordan, United States of America

Tech stack

Java
Artificial Intelligence
Application Performance Management
Mobile Application Development
Cloud Computing
Code Review
Continuous Integration
Database Design
Software Debugging
Desktop Computing
DevOps
Distributed Systems
Java Persistence API
Oracle
Open Web Application Security
Secure Coding
Software Engineering
SQL Databases
Systems Architecture
Systems Integration
Data Logging
Diagnostic Tools
Backend
Vue.js
Hybris
Front End Software Development
Kibana
REST
Legacy Systems
Jenkins
Microservices

Job description

The Software Engineer 3 is a technical leader and strategic partner within the technology team, responsible for owning the architecture, delivery, and performance of business-critical backend applications and systems integrations. This role balances deep backend expertise with cross-functional agility-contributing to frontend applications, CI/CD pipelines, and observability practices as needed. Serving as a mentor to junior developers and an advocate for modern, AI-assisted engineering workflows, this individual ensures our engineering ecosystems remain scalable, secure, and closely aligned with enterprise business goals., * Establish and reinforce code quality standards through code reviews, testing, and maintainable design practices

  • Design and implement complex systems while balancing scalability, performance, maintainability, and operational reliability
  • Analyze application performance, algorithm efficiency, and system architecture to improve reliability and long-term maintainability
  • Identify security vulnerabilities and insecure coding practices, including common OWASP-related issues, and promote secure development practices across the team
  • Research and integrate modern AI-assisted and agentic development workflows into the software development lifecycle
  • Mentor junior engineers through technical guidance, collaboration, and code reviews
  • Perform other duties as assigned, * The employee may be required to exert up to 10 lbs. of force occasionally and/or a negligible amount of force frequently or constantly to lift, carry, push, pull, or otherwise move objects, including the human body. Involves sitting most of the time, but may involve walking or standing for brief periods of time
  • Specific vision abilities required by this job include near acuity at 20 inches or less due to computer work
  • While performing the duties of this job, the employee will experience a moderate noise level (i.e. business office with computers, phone, and printers, light traffic)

Requirements

  • Strong proficiency in Java and Spring-based application development
  • Strong background in REST APIs and systems integration
  • Proficiency with JPA, SQL, and enterprise database design
  • Familiarity with Vue or comparable front-end frameworks
  • Hands-on work with Jenkins pipelines and CI/CD workflows
  • Working knowledge of observability, logging, and diagnostic tools such as Kibana
  • Strong debugging skills across distributed and integrated systems
  • Demonstrated ownership of production systems in live environments
  • Ability to translate business requirements into practical technical solutions
  • Background in retail or eCommerce platforms, * 5+ years in professional software engineering
  • Familiarity with microservice architecture and distributed systems
  • Exposure to cloud infrastructure and DevOps practices
  • Experience with AI-assisted engineering workflows, including .claude configuration and agentic development tooling
  • Experience supporting and modernizing legacy applications
  • Familiarity with Android or other mobile application development a plus
  • Knowledge of Oracle databases a plus
  • Knowledge of SAP Commerce / Hybris a plus
  • Familiarity with Retail.net a plus

Apply for this position